2013-11-11 2 views
0

После установки HWIOauthBundle и успешного прохождения процесса OAuth для Github я оказался потерянным.Как сохранить user_token, полученный от поставщика с помощью HWIOAuthBundle?

Вот проблема: мне нужно, чтобы пользовательский токен сохранялся, чтобы я мог использовать его более одного раза, не прося пользователя снова пройти процесс. Я не уверен, что для этого можно использовать HWIOAuthBundle, или если мне нужно реализовать специализированную службу для этой цели.

Может быть, HWIOAuthBundle запускает событие, когда оно получает данные от провайдера, поэтому я могу просто подключить слушателя и сохранить его. Пожалуйста, если кто-то это сделал или имеет какое-либо представление о наилучшем способе сделать это, ответьте на это.

Я ценю, что вы нашли время, чтобы прочитать это. Благодарю.

ответ

0

Я нашел aswer здесь: https://gist.github.com/danvbe/4476697, хотя я резко изменил логику для удовлетворения моих конкретных требований.

Я могу получить токен для пользователя и упорствовать в нем без проблем.

Смежные вопросы